  • Patent number: 9653896
    Abstract: An electrical enclosure includes a first wall having an exhaust opening, a second wall, and a third wall. The electrical enclosure also includes at least one circuit breaker compartment, a line compartment arranged between the third wall and the at least one circuit breaker compartment, and an exhaust duct extending through the electrical enclosure between the first wall and the second wall. The exhaust duct is fluidically connected to the exhaust opening and each of the at least one circuit breaker compartments. At least one passage extends between the line compartment and the at least one circuit breaker compartment through the exhaust duct. The at least one passage is substantially fluidically isolated from the exhaust duct.

  • Publication number: 20170032325
    Abstract: A social networking system receives a search query from a user, and the system identifies entities as a function of the search query. The system retrieves attributes that are associated with the user, and retrieves attributes that are associated with the entities. The system determines matches between the attributes that are associated with the user and the attributes that are associated with the entities, and displays data relating to the entities and the matches on a computer display device.

  • Publication number: 20160295730
    Abstract: An electrical enclosure includes at least one circuit breaker compartment and a cover mounted thereon. The cover includes an opening receptive of at least one circuit breaker. A gasket extends about at least a portion of the opening. The gasket includes an inner seal assembly and an outer seal assembly. The outer seal assembly is positioned to engage the at least one circuit breaker when the cover is in a closed position. The inner seal assembly is movable between a non-deployed configuration spaced from the at least one circuit breaker and a deployed configuration engaged with the at least one circuit breaker. The inner seal assembly is responsive to a pressure wave in the at least one circuit breaker compartment to move from the non-deployed configuration to the deployed configuration and substantially prevent out gassing through the opening in the cover.

  • Publication number: 20160132834
    Abstract: Techniques for assisting a user in conducting an online job search for online job listings are described. According to various embodiments, a user specification of a job search query including at least one user-specified job search query term is received. Values for one or more member profile attributes of the user are then accessed. Thereafter, the job search query is modified based on the accessed values for the member profile attributes of the user, the modifying comprising inserting job search query terms corresponding to the values for the member profile attributes into the job search query. Search results corresponding to job listings posted on the job search engine are then generated, based on the modified job search query. Further, one or more of the search results may be displayed, via a user interface.

  • Publication number: 20160124958
    Abstract: Disclosed in some examples are methods, systems, and machine-readable mediums which provide for a personalized expertise searching. When a user of the social networking service enters a search query, the system determines if the user is searching for members who possess a particular skill. If the user is searching for members who possess a particular skill, the search results are post-processed by personalizing the search results using one or more machine-learning models which utilize one or more observed features about the user that enters the query, the skills of the members of the social networking service, and the query itself. In some examples, the system may utilize multiple machine-learning models in multiple passes to fine tune the relevance of the search results and to ensure that the post-processing returns search results in a timely manner.

  • Patent number: 9325182
    Abstract: A surface-mountable electric vehicle charging station is disclosed. The charging station includes a housing, a first mounting member having a first coupling portion and a first locking portion, including a first locking aperture therethrough, and a second mounting member having a second coupling portion coupleable to the first coupling portion to prevent a movement of the housing in one of a first and a second direction. The second mounting member also includes a second locking portion with a latch surface. One of the mounting members is coupleable to the housing, and the other mounting member is coupleable to the mounting surface. A lock member is disposed in the first locking aperture, movable between a first disengaged position and a second engaged position. The lock member cooperates with the latch surface in the second engaged position, to prevent a movement of the housing in a third direction.
